Select Brand:

Show All

£115.26

Dispatch on next business day

£36.75

Dispatch on next business day

£26.67

Dispatch on next business day

£55.90

Dispatch on next business day

£34.68

Dispatch on next business day

£154.62

Dispatch on next business day

£20.39

Dispatch on next business day

£24.53

Dispatch on next business day

£55.45

Dispatch on next business day

£54.71

Dispatch on next business day

£55.26

Dispatch on next business day

£59.47

Dispatch on next business day